Book Description

August 21, 2000
With this great guide to celebrating the spirit (and spirits) of Halloween, no special magic is needed to enjoy the latest trend in family fun. Tricks & Treats has tons of great ideas for Halloween costumes, decorations, parties and tempting fun foods. Over 50 projects.

2.0 out of 5 stars A Christmas book with pumpkins, September 10, 2004
By 
This review is from: Tricks and Treats (Paperback)
What I found really weird about this book was (besides having nothing really new or interesting in it) was that it was essentially a Christmas craft and gift book with a Halloween theme overlay.

What I've always enjoyed about Halloween is that it is a time to do fun and goofy things that you don't normally do during the rest of the year - dress up like a rock star, dangle fake bodies in your yard, make food that looks like trash.

I feel like this book misses the spirit of Halloween while relying on the basic expectations of the Christmas holiday to do alot of hand-made gifts, and annoyingly complicated recipes.

If you are an accomplished craft maker or seamstress, you might get some ideas from this book, but for the average person hosting a Halloween party or dressing your kids lookng for new ideas, I'd look elsewhere.

1.0 out of 5 stars Should be called Ultimate Country Kitsch & Patterns, April 22, 2007
By 
ScaryJerry (Santa Clara, CA) - See all my reviews
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Tricks and Treats (Paperback)
The majority of this book is simply country kitsch, costume patterns, and patterns for a crocheted pumpkin vests complete with applicaques... scary and not in the good way. The photography also seems very dated, like it may have been compiled in the 80s. Maybe some would find this book "ever-so-charming" or even "oh-my-stars-delightful", but its not for the modern Halloween enthusiast. I'm a huge fan of the Martha Stewart Halloween book and I keep looking for other good books on Halloween.
